A protein subunit from an enzyme is part of a research study and needs to be characterized. A total of 0.145 g of this subunit w
Hitman42 [59]

Answer:

The molar mass of the protein is 12982.8 g/mol.

Explanation:

The osmptic pressure is given by:

π=MRT

Where,

M: is molarity of the solution

R: the ideal gas constant (0.0821 L·atm/mol·K)

T: the temperature in kelvins

Hence, we look for molarity:

0.138 atm=M(0.0821\frac{l*atm}{mol*K} )(28+273K)

M=\frac{0.138atm}{(0.0821\frac{l*atm}{mol*K} )(301K)}= =5.584×10⁻³mol/l

As we have 2 ml of solution, we can get the moles quantity:

Moles of protein: 5.584×10⁻³\frac{mol}{l}\frac{1l}{1000ml}×2ml=1.117×10⁻⁵mol

Finally, the moles quantity is the division between the mass of the protein and the molar mass of the protein, so:

Moles=Mass/Molar mass

Molar mass= Mass/Moles=\frac{0.145g}{1.117*10^{-5}mol}=12982.8 g/mol

In the following list, only ________ is not an example of a chemical reaction. the production of hydrogen gas from water the tar
Vika [28.1K]

Answer: Option (c) is the correct answer.

Explanation:

A chemical reaction is defined as the reaction where a chemical bond will break in order to form a new bond due to the formation of a new substance.

For example, 2Na + Cl_{2} \rightarrow 2NaCl

Here, NaCl is the new substance that is formed. A chemical reaction will always bring change in chemical composition of a substance.

The production of hydrogen gas from water, the tarnishing of a copper penny, charging a cellular phone and burning a plastic water bottle are all chemical reactions.

Whereas a reaction where no change in chemical composition of a substance takes place is known as a physical reaction.

For example, chopping a log into sawdust will change the shape but it will not bring any change in chemical composition of the substance.

Thus, we can conclude that in the following list, only chopping a log into sawdust is not an example of a chemical reaction.
